NOTE ON SYSTEMA: All PIG items with "[SYSTEMA]" in the product title are related to the PIG Brig Plate Carrier and PIG Brig Chest Rig product family. Please refer to the product descriptions for how each respective SYSTEMA product relates to the product family.
The Hybrid Foam & Spacer Mesh construction of the ALL-NEW PIG BRIG Shoulder Pad Set provides optimal padding and ventilation for the PIG BRIG Plate Carrier . With minimum weight and bulk, the BRIG Shoulder Pad Set enhances weight-bearing comfort tremendously. When wearing the BRIG directly over clothing (and not over a soft armor vest), adding the BRIG Shoulder Pad Set with a set of PIG AFC Pontoons will bring the comfort level on par with the PIG Plate Carrier.
These shoulder pads will fit any strap up to 2" wide.
Features:
- Pad dimensions: 10" x 2.25"
- 1/4" Closed Cell Foam
- OneWrap 'wings' 5" apart
Made in the USA!
